Engine and Performance: The Heart of the Beast

At the core of the 12Cilindri Spider lies a naturally aspirated 6.5-liter V12 engine, a powerplant that stands as a testament to Ferrari’s commitment to traditional high-performance engines in an era increasingly dominated by downsizing and electrification. This mechanical marvel produces an astounding 819 horsepower at 9,250 rpm and 500 lb-ft of torque at 7,250 rpm, propelling the car from 0-62 mph in just 2.9 seconds and achieving a top speed of over 211 mph.

The engine’s performance is further enhanced by Ferrari’s innovative technology:

  1. Lightweight Components: Titanium connecting rods, lightened pistons, and a lightened crankshaft contribute to the engine’s ability to rev to an incredible 9,500 rpm redline.
  2. Advanced Fuel Injection: The engine features fuel injection at over 5,000 PSI with three injection and ignition events per cycle, optimizing combustion efficiency.
  3. Aspirated Torque Shaping (ATS): This technology optimizes the torque curve in second and third gears, ensuring smooth yet explosive acceleration.

The 12Cilindri Spider’s powertrain is completed by an 8-speed dual-clutch transmission, delivering lightning-fast gear changes that are imperceptible when cruising and thrillingly quick when pushing the car to its limits.

Chassis and Handling: Precision Engineering

Despite its grand tourer classification, the 12Cilindri Spider exhibits the agility and precision typically associated with more focused sports cars. Ferrari has implemented a range of advanced technologies to ensure the Spider delivers an exhilarating driving experience:

  1. Independent Rear-Wheel Steering: This system enhances the car’s agility and stability, particularly during high-speed cornering.
  2. ABS Evo: An evolution of Ferrari’s anti-lock braking system, providing optimal braking performance in all conditions.
  3. Side Slip Control: This advanced traction control system allows for controlled slides when desired, showcasing the car’s playful yet manageable nature.
  4. Electronically Controlled Differential: Ensures optimal power distribution to the rear wheels, enhancing traction and cornering ability.

The 12Cilindri Spider also features a semi-active MagneRide suspension system, striking a perfect balance between comfort and performance. This, combined with the car’s relatively high tire sidewalls on 21-inch wheels, contributes to a ride that is both compliant and controlled.

The 12Cilindri Spider’s design is a masterful blend of classic Ferrari styling cues and modern aerodynamic principles. The car pays homage to iconic models like the 275 GTB/4 and 365 GTB4 Daytona, while incorporating futuristic elements that hint at Ferrari’s forward-thinking approach.

Key design features include:

  1. Distinctive Front End: A sharp, beak-like front grille that echoes classic Ferrari designs while incorporating modern LED lighting technology.
  2. Sculpted Sides: Flowing lines and carefully crafted air intakes that not only enhance the car’s visual appeal but also serve crucial aerodynamic functions.
  3. Retractable Hardtop: The folding roof mechanism is a work of art in itself, operating silently and capable of opening or closing in just 14 seconds at speeds up to 28 mph.
  4. Rear Aerodynamic Flaps: These distinctive elements at the rear can contribute up to 50kg of additional downforce at 150mph, ensuring high-speed stability.

The Spider variant adds only 132 pounds to the car’s weight compared to the coupe, a testament to Ferrari’s lightweight engineering approach. This minimal weight gain ensures that the Spider retains the coupe’s dynamic capabilities while offering the added thrill of open-top driving.

Interior and Technology: Luxury Meets Innovation

Step inside the 12Cilindri Spider, and you’re greeted by an interior that perfectly balances luxury, sportiness, and cutting-edge technology:

  1. Driver-Focused Cockpit: The interior layout is designed to put all essential controls within easy reach of the driver, emphasizing the car’s performance-oriented nature.
  2. Advanced Infotainment: A 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ster is complemented by an 11.9-inch portrait-oriented touchscreen infotainment system, offering seamless integration of vehicle controls and entertainment functions.
  3. Passenger Display: A unique feature allowing the passenger to view performance data and assist with navigation.
  4. Premium Materials: High-quality leather, carbon fiber, and metal accents create an ambiance of luxury and sophistication.
  5. Comfort Features: Heated and electronically adjustable seats, dual-zone climate control, and a wireless smartphone charging pad come standard.

The 12Cilindri Spider also boasts impressive practicality for a high-performance convertible, with a 200-liter boot capacity even with the roof down, making it suitable for grand touring adventures.

Driving Experience: A Symphony of Sensations

Behind the wheel, the 12Cilindri Spider offers a driving experience that is nothing short of extraordinary. The car’s character can transform from a docile grand tourer to a ferocious supercar at the press of a button or the flex of a right foot.

At low speeds and in urban environments, the 12Cilindri Spider surprises with its civility. The engine note is subdued, almost whisper-quiet, allowing for discreet navigation through city streets. The smooth power delivery and compliant suspension make for a comfortable ride, belying the car’s immense performance potential.

However, as the revs climb and the road opens up, the 12Cilindri Spider reveals its true nature. From around 6,000 rpm, the V12 engine’s voice transforms from a gentle purr to a spine-tingling howl, urging the driver to push harder and explore the upper reaches of the rev range. The acceleration is relentless, with each gear change from the dual-clutch transmission providing an addictive surge of power.

In corners, the 12Cilindri Spider displays remarkable poise and balance. The rear-wheel steering system and electronic differential work in harmony to provide incredible agility and traction. The car’s steering is precise and communicative, allowing the driver to place the car with confidence through turns. Despite its grand tourer designation, the 12Cilindri Spider exhibits handling characteristics that would put many dedicated sports cars to shame.

With the roof down, the driving experience reaches new heights. Ferrari has paid careful attention to aerodynamics, ensuring that wind buffeting is minimized even at high speeds. The car’s advanced air management system creates a bubble of calm air around the cockpit, allowing occupants to enjoy the V12’s glorious soundtrack without excessive wind noise.

The brake-by-wire system, while initially feeling a tad unusual, quickly fades into the background, providing strong and consistent stopping power. This, combined with the car’s advanced stability systems, inspires confidence when pushing the car to its limits.

Market Positioning and Competition

The 2025 Ferrari 12Cilindri Spider enters a rarefied segment of the automotive market, competing with other high-end grand tourers and supercars. Its primary rivals include:

  1. Aston Martin DBS Volante
  2. Bentley Continental GT Convertible
  3. Lamborghini Aventador Roadster (if still in production)
  4. McLaren 750S Spider

With a base price of £366,500 (approximately $465,000 USD), the 12Cilindri Spider positions itself at the pinnacle of the grand tourer market. While this price point puts it out of reach for all but the most affluent buyers, it’s in line with expectations for a flagship Ferrari model.

The 12Cilindri Spider distinguishes itself from its competitors through its naturally aspirated V12 engine, a rarity in an era of widespread turbocharging and hybridization. This, combined with Ferrari’s racing pedigree and brand cachet, makes the 12Cilindri Spider a highly desirable option for collectors and enthusiasts alike.

Environmental Considerations

In an age of increasing environmental awareness, the 12Cilindri Spider’s fuel-hungry V12 engine might seem anachronistic. Ferrari has made efforts to improve efficiency where possible, implementing technologies like stop-start and cylinder deactivation. However, with a fuel economy rating of 18.2 mpg and CO2 emissions of 353g/km, the 12Cilindri Spider is undeniably a car that prioritizes performance over environmental concerns.

It’s worth noting that Ferrari has plans to introduce its first fully electric vehicle in the near future, signaling the brand’s acknowledgment of the need to adapt to changing market demands and regulatory requirements. In this context, the 12Cilindri Spider can be seen as a celebration of the traditional high-performance internal combustion engine, perhaps one of the last of its kind from Ferrari.
